Proto-Indo-Europeans speakers lived in Anatolia

The Near-Eastern or Armenian Model proposes speakers of Proto-Indo-European lived in northern Mesopotamia, eastern Anatolia (modern-day Turkey), and the southern Caucasus.

  1. Proto-Indo-Europeans speakers lived on Near-Eastern Homeland
    Over time, the Proto-Indo-European homeland ranged from eastern Anatolia to the southern Caucasus and Northern Mesopotamia. In present-day terms, this includes Turkey, Armenia, Azerbaijan, Georgia, Syria, and Iraq.
